Validation of near infrared transmission spectroscopy for its application in wheat quality control. [Master thesis]
2006
Pojic, M.
This study describes characteristics of NIRS method, as well as its importance for wheat quality control, whether in industrial or laboratory environment. Due to the fact that application of NIRS method is non-regulated, one of the objectives of the present study was to give an overview of necessary requirements, parameters and methodology for validation of near infrared spectroscopy method, especially for moisture, protein, wet gluten and sedimentation value determination on whole wheat grain. Two sets of wheat samples were used in investigation which characteristics were similar to the wheat samples that will be used in a routine NIRS application. The obtained results indicated a relationship between the reference analytical methods and NIRS method for determination of relevant whole wheat quality parameters as well as contributed to validity demonstration on any analytical procedure. Also, obtained results enabled its reliable use wheather it referes to the single instrument or to the network of instruments.
